Booking Your Eurostar Tickets

book eurostar tickets early

When you’re ready to commence your unforgettable journey from London to Paris, booking your Eurostar tickets is the first step to make it happen.

Eurostar offers various ticket types, including Standard, Standard Premier, and Business Premier. Each option caters to different needs, whether you’re looking for budget-friendly travel or a more luxurious experience.

To secure the best prices, book your tickets well in advance, as fares tend to rise closer to your departure date. Keep an eye out for promotions and special offers, which can save you a significant amount.

Booking your Eurostar tickets early ensures you get the best prices, while promotions can lead to significant savings.

Don’t forget to check the Eurostar website for the most up-to-date information about your journey.

Lastly, consider traveling during off-peak hours for a more relaxed experience, as trains are often less crowded then.

Are There Luggage Restrictions on Eurostar Trains?

Yes, there are luggage restrictions on Eurostar trains.

You can take two bags up to 85cm in height and one smaller item, like a handbag or laptop, without incurring baggage fees.

Just make sure your items fit those dimensions. If you exceed the allowance, you might face additional baggage fees.

What Is the Duration of the Train Journey From London to Paris?

The train journey from London to Paris typically takes around 2 hours and 15 minutes.

You’ll find frequent train schedules, making it easy to plan your trip. Tickets vary in prices depending on the time and how far in advance you book. For the best deals, consider checking early.

The swift ride whisks you through the Channel Tunnel, letting you arrive in the heart of Paris ready to explore!
